yYur morning joe could be used to make a pair of sneakers. Start up company, Rens, makes new kicks from old grounds. It takes 21 cups and 6 recycled plastic bottles to make each pair. 5,000 backers have pledged a half million dollars so far to make this happen, as it helps cut back on waste and reduces methane emissions. The shoes come in 9 colors, waterproof, and absorb odors. Today’s latte could be tomorrow’s carbon footprint.
